Output 8c75f1760491430a14b2de24d93e9178feffb415e19f39eb38d4e60eb0dad7a7:0

value
57026
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 7dd0366164c944184e351d0eea2b458913b9f3fc OP_EQUALVERIFY OP_CHECKSIG
address
1CUEtqEZEGFyFtrLAJqsVp1ySHwa9vw9Yi
transaction
8c75f1760491430a14b2de24d93e9178feffb415e19f39eb38d4e60eb0dad7a7
confirmations
29391
spent
true